What are part-time computer jobs?

Part-time computer jobs are roles that involve working with computers or information technology on a reduced or flexible schedule, typically less than 35-40 hours per week. These jobs can include positions such as IT support, data entry, web development, software testing, or graphic design. Part-time computer jobs are ideal for students, parents, or anyone seeking work-life balance while utilizing their technical skills. They may be found in offices, remotely, or on a freelance basis, depending on the employer and the nature of the work.

What are some typical responsibilities and expectations for a part-time computer lab assistant?

As a part-time computer lab assistant, you are typically responsible for monitoring the lab environment, providing technical support to users, maintaining equipment, and ensuring lab policies are followed. You may also assist with installing software updates, troubleshooting hardware or software issues, and answering basic IT-related questions from students or staff. The role often requires strong communication skills and the ability to manage multiple tasks efficiently in a sometimes fast-paced setting. Collaboration with IT staff and other lab assistants is common, and the position can provide valuable hands-on experience for those interested in pursuing a technology career.
